首页--工业技术论文--自动化技术、计算机技术论文--自动化技术及设备论文--自动化系统论文--自动控制、自动控制系统论文

基于IEC61131-3的PLC编程软件的研究与设计

摘要第1-5页
Abstract第5-9页
1 绪论第9-19页
   ·PLC 的发展和趋势第9-13页
     ·PLC 的发展现状第9-10页
     ·PLC 的发展趋势第10-12页
     ·国内PLC 的发展现状第12-13页
   ·编程软件在国内外的发展状况第13-16页
     ·国外PLC 编程软件的发展状况第13-15页
     ·国内PLC 编程软件的发展状况第15-16页
   ·课题研究的目的与意义第16-17页
   ·本课题的主要工作第17-18页
   ·本章小结第18-19页
2 PLC 编程软件的需求分析和总体设计第19-30页
   ·PLC 标准编程语言 IEC61131-3第19-23页
     ·IEC61131 标准的构成第19页
     ·IEC61131-3 的基本内容第19-21页
     ·IEC61131-3 的编程语言第21-23页
   ·PLC 编程软件的生命周期第23-27页
     ·软件计划第23-24页
     ·软件需求分析第24-25页
     ·软件设计第25-27页
     ·软件编码第27页
     ·软件测试第27页
     ·软件维护第27页
   ·PLC 编程软件的总体设计方案第27-29页
   ·本章小结第29-30页
3 编辑器的设计第30-49页
   ·梯形图编辑器的设计第30-41页
     ·梯形图编辑器的设计目标第30-31页
     ·梯形图元件库的设计第31-35页
     ·梯形图的存储第35-39页
     ·梯形图编辑器具体实现第39-41页
   ·指令表编辑器的设计第41-48页
     ·指令表编辑器的设计目标第42页
     ·指令表语言结构第42-44页
     ·指令设置第44-47页
     ·指令表编辑器具体实现第47-48页
   ·本章小结第48-49页
4 编译器的设计第49-64页
   ·编译器的结构第49-51页
   ·词法分析第51页
   ·语法分析第51-53页
     ·自顶向下分析第52页
     ·自底向上分析第52-53页
   ·语义分析第53-54页
   ·中间代码生成第54-57页
     ·后缀式中间代码第55-56页
     ·三地址中间代码第56-57页
   ·代码优化第57-58页
     ·优化的目标和要求第57-58页
     ·优化的内容第58页
     ·中序遍历第58页
   ·具体实现第58-63页
   ·本章小结第63-64页
5 PLC 编程软件的界面设计第64-75页
   ·界面设计的主要内容第64-65页
   ·主框架的设计第65-67页
     ·功能要求第65页
     ·具体实现第65-67页
   ·菜单的设计第67-71页
     ·设计方法第67-68页
     ·菜单设计具体实现第68-71页
   ·工具栏的设计第71-74页
   ·本章小结第74-75页
6 编程软件的工程应用实例第75-91页
   ·小车装卸料系统控制要求第75页
   ·系统PLC 程序设计第75-80页
   ·上位MCGS 监控系统的设计第80-88页
     ·MCGS 组态软件功能第80-81页
     ·MCGS 与 PLC 连接第81-82页
     ·驱动程序的设计第82-84页
     ·监控画面设计第84-88页
   ·PLC 的通信程序的设计第88-90页
     ·读写缓冲区的划分第88页
     ·PLC 的串口读写方式第88-90页
   ·本章小结第90-91页
结论和展望第91-92页
参考文献第92-94页
攻读硕士学位期间发表学术论文情况第94-95页
致谢第95-96页

论文共96页,点击 下载论文
上一篇:基于多层网络的Q系列PLC三维伺服控制系统研究
下一篇:交流电压/电流智能传感器信号处理技术的研究